Why is it difficult to enforce? Govt will instruct Telcos and ISP's to ban access to the IP.

Many Nigerians have been talking about VPN but it means Govt has partially achieved their purpose. What's trending is one of the most important features of Twitter. Where you are browsing from plays a major role in the feature algorithm. The only way our youths can defeat this is to agree to choose one small country in the VPN and we dominate it. If we dominate a small country through VPN and force the algorithm our way, the citizens of the country will start complaining too if they are seeing Nigerian topics trending so much in their country. Our Telcos and ISP's intelligent firewalls will suspect too and ban those VPN's traffic.
